Öğrenme Kazanımları (Tanım)
  • Süt Teknolojisi konusunda çeşitli disiplinler arasındaki etkileşimi kavrama; yeni ve karmaşık fikirleri analiz, sentez ve değerlendirmede uzmanlık gerektiren bilgileri kullanarak özgün sonuçlara ulaşma.
  • Yüksek lisans yeterliklerine dayalı olarak uzmanlık alanındaki yeni, güncel ve ileri düzeydeki bilgileri özgün düşünce ve/veya araştırma ile uzmanlık düzeyinde geliştirme, derinleştirme ve bilime yenilik getirecek özgün tanımlara ulaşma.
  • Konusunda yeni bilgilere sistematik bir biçimde yaklaşabilme ve süt teknolojisi ile ilgili araştırma yöntemlerinde üst düzeyde beceri kazanabilme.
  • Uzmanlaştığı alanda (gıda teknolojisleri, ürün geliştirme, ürün kalitesinin artırımı, gıda güvenliği, mikrobiyoloji vb.) gıda sektöründe danışmanlık yapabilecek düzeyde donanıma sahip.
  • Konusunda bilime yenilik getiren, yeni bir bilimsel yöntem geliştirebilme ya da bilinen bir yöntemi farklı bir alana uygulayabilme, özgün bir konuyu araştırabilme, kavrayabilme, tasarlayabilme, uyarlayabilme ve uygulayabilme.
  • Yeni ve karmaşık fikirlerin eleştirel analizini, sentezini ve değerlendirmesini yapabilme.
  • Akademik düzeyde araştırma organize edip gerçekleştirme ve lisans seviyesinde ders verebilme.
  • Süt Teknolojisi alanı ile ilgili bir bilimsel makaleyi ulusal ve/veya uluslar arası hakemli dergilerde yayınlayarak alanındaki bilginin sınırlarını genişletebilme.
  • Uzmanlaştığı alanda firma ve işletme kurabilme, denetliyebilme ve işletimini devam ettirebilme.
  • Yaratıcı ve eleştirel düşünme, sorun çözme ve karar verme gibi üst düzey zihinsel süreçleri kullanarak alanı ile ilgili yeni fikir ve yöntemler geliştirebilme.
  • Sosyal ilişkileri ve bu ilişkileri yönlendiren normları eleştirel bir bakış açısıyla inceleme, bunları geliştirme ve gerektiğinde değiştirmeye yönelik eylemleri yönetebilme.
  • Uzman bir topluluk içinde özgün görüşlerini savunmada yetkinliğini gösteren etkili bir iletişim kurabilme.
  • En az bir yabancı dilde, ileri düzeyde yazılı, sözlü ve görsel iletişim kurabilme ve tartışabilme.
  • Akademik ve profesyonel bağlamda teknolojik, sosyal veya kültürel ilerlemeleri tanıtarak, bilgi toplumu olma sürecine katkıda bulunma.
  • Sorun çözmede stratejik karar verme süreçlerini kullanarak işlevsel etkileşim kurabilme.
  • Alanında ve iş yaşamında karşılaşılan toplumsal, bilimsel ve etik konularda çözüm üretebilme ve bu değerlerin gelişimini destekleyebilme.

Access Requirements

The applicants who hold a Master's Degree and willing to enroll in the Doctorate programme may apply to the Directorate of Graduate School with the documents. 1-Sufficient score (at least 55 out of 100) from the Academic Staff and Graduate Study Education Exam (ALES) conducted by Student Selection and Placement Center (OSYM) or GRE Graduate Record Examination (GRE) score or Graduate Management Admission Test (GMAT) score equivalent to ALES score of 55. 2-English proficiency (at least 70 out of 100 from the Profiency Exam conducted by Ege University Foreign Language Department, or at least 55 out of 100 from ÜDS (University Language Examination conducted by OSYM) or TOEFL or IELTS score equivalent to UDS score of 55. The candidates holding Bachelor's or Master's Degree taught totally in English are exempted from English proficiency requirement. The candidates fulfilling the criteria outlined above are invited to interwiev. The assessment for admission to masters programs is based on : 50% of ALES, 15% of academic success in the undergraduate programme (cumulative grade point average (CGPA) ) 10 % of academic success in the master's programme and 25% of interview grade. The required minimum interview grade is 60 out of 100. The candidates having an assessed score of 65 at least are accepted into the Doctorate programme. The results of the evaluation are announced by the Directorate of Graduate School.

Conditions for SuccessThe doctorate programme consists of a minimum of seven courses, with a minimum of 21 national credits, a qualifying examination, a dissertation proposal, and a dissertation. The period allotted for the completion of the Doctorate programmes is normally eight semesters (four years). However, while it is possible to graduate in a shorter time, it is also possible to have an extension subject to the approval of the graduate school. The seminar course and thesis are non-credit and graded on a pass/fail basis. The total ECTS credits of the programme is 240 ECTS. A student may take undergraduate courses on the condition that the courses have not been taken during the undergraduate program. However, at most two of these courses may be counted to the Doctorate course load and credits. The PhD students are required to take the Doctoral Qualifying Examination, after having successfully completed taught courses. The examination consists of written and oral parts. The Doctoral Qualifying Committee determines by absolute majority whether a candidate has passed or failed the examination. Students who fail the Qualifying Examination may retake the examination the following semester. Students failing the Examination a second time are dismissed from the program. Students must register for thesis work and the Specialization Field course offered by his supervisor every semester following the semester, in which the supervisor is appointed. A dissertation supervisor who must hold the minimum rank of assistant professor is appointed for each PhD student. When the nature of the dissertation topic requires more than one supervisor, a joint-supervisor may be appointed. A joint-supervisor must hold a doctoral degree. Periodic monitoring of research work by a thesis monitoring committee is required to be awarded the Doctoral degree. A student who has completed work on the thesis within the time period, must write a thesis, using the data collected, according to the specifications of the Graduate School Thesis Writing Guide. The thesis must be defended in front of a jury. The thesis jury is appointed on the recommendations of the relevant Department Chairperson and with the approval of the Administrative Committee of the Graduate School. The jury is composed of the thesis supervisor and 5 faculty members. Of the appointed jury members, up to two may be selected from another Department or another University. The co-supervisor cannot be the jury member. Thesis defense by the candidate is open to all audience and a jury decides to grant/deny the Doctoral degree. A majority vote by the jury members determines the outcome of the thesis or examination. The vote can be for "acceptance", "rejection" or "correction". A student may be given, by a decision of the Administrative Committee of the Graduate School, up to six months to complete the corrections. The student must then retake the thesis examination.
